# Break-glass: Fennimore serverless platform

Cold starts on Fennimore handlers can stretch to 12s when the warm pool drains, which sometimes masquerades as an outage. Before invoking break-glass, confirm it is genuine unavailability, not cold-start latency, by checking the warmer dashboard. Break-glass grants temporary operator rights to force-provision warm instances; every use is logged and reviewed. The break-glass vault prompts for the recovery passphrase written below.

vault phrase of bagaf-kajeg = jorath-feniel-briir-siliel-ralix

Subject: Badge System Migration — Contractor Access This Week

Dear contractors,

The front desk at Tarnwell Plaza is migrating to the new Keystile badge platform this week. Existing contractor badges will stop working on Thursday at noon. Until replacement badges are issued, please sign in at reception as usual and collect a paper day pass. During the changeover, the side entrance on Elmgate Row will remain your designated access point, and you can enter using the temporary code below.

Regards,
Front Desk

turnstile pass: bdg-YPPQB-52010

## Holiday-Period Opening Hours

During the December closure, the Fenholt Building runs on reduced access. Main doors lock at 18:00 instead of 22:00, and the atrium is unstaffed after that time. Night shift staff should enter via the east stairwell only; the west entrance alarm stays armed throughout the holiday period. Cleaning crews will not attend between the 24th and the 2nd. The east stairwell keypad accepts the holiday code below.

turnstile pass: bdg-FVNQRS-72965873

Q: Does the Kestrelbase bloom filter need rebuilding before a release?

A: Only if the key count grew more than 30% since the last rebuild. The filter fronts the KV store to skip pointless disk lookups; a stale one just raises false positives, it never returns wrong data. Rebuilds take ~20 minutes and can run live. Check the current fill ratio on the internal page here.

operations page: https://jenkins.zemvarcloud.local/job/merge_requests/repo/build/73930b4b30f0a8ed